Regional policy on character enhancement and preservation
Regional policy aims to enhance or preserve the character and appearance of areas. There is a general presumption against demolition of unlisted buildings except in exceptional circumstances.
Regional policy aims to enhance the character or appearance of the area where an opportunity to do so exists, or to preserve its character or appearance where an opportunity to enhance does not arise. There is also a general presumption against demolition of unlisted buildings that should only be relaxed in exceptional circumstances.
